Louis J. Buchholtz is a scholar working on Condensed Matter Physics,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ics. According to data from OpenAlex, Louis J. Buchholtz has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 674 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Condensed Matter Physics, 16 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 2 papers in Statistical and Nonlinear Physics. Recurrent topics in Louis J. Buchholtz’s work include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ism (16 papers), Quantum, superfluid, helium dynamics (14 papers) and Cold Atom Physics and Bose-Einstein Condensates (7 papers). Louis J. Buchholtz is often cited by papers focused on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ism (16 papers), Quantum, superfluid, helium dynamics (14 papers) and Cold Atom Physics and Bose-Einstein Condensates (7 papers). Louis J. Buchholtz collaborates with scholars based in United States and Germany. Louis J. Buchholtz's co-authors include Mario Palumbo, D. Rainer, J. A. Sauls, David Kagan and Alexander L. Fetter and has published in prestigious journals such as Physics Letters A, American Journal of Physics and Physical review. B, Condensed matter.
